* Stephanie made a surprise return on night 2 of ''[=WrestleMania=] XL'', earning her one of the biggest pops in her career. The last time she'd been involved with WWE in any capacity was her briefly stepping up as co-CEO of the company following [[Wrestling/VinceMcMahon her father's]] retirement in 2022, which abruptly ended with her stepping down and laying low when Vince (briefly) returned as chairman in 2023. With Vince leaving ''again'' in January 2024, this time for good, speculation over where Stephanie could be ran rampant, with many believing this may end up being the first [=WrestleMania=] without a [=McMahon=]... [[ShesBack so it came as a pleasant surprise that she returned to kick off the Show of Shows in grand fashion]], delivering one of her most hype promos ever in ushering a new era for WWE.

* At Payback 2014 she has a segment where she's trying to convinve Daniel Bryan to relinquish the WWE World Heavyweight Championship [[note]] Daniel was legit injured at the time, but the hope was to stall him having to relinquish the title long enough he could heal up [[/note]]. Being Chicago, a huge CM Punk chant breaks out - and without missing a beat (or even changing expression), Steph works it into the segment, telling Bryan "See? These fans want you to give up, just like Punk did." In one move, she shuts the crowd down totally, mocks Bryan AND Punk, and gets a ton of heat on herself.
